Translation of going into German,

Noun

1.

forward movement

progress or advancement
  • The going is good so far in the project..Der Fortschritt ist bisher gut im Projekt
2.

departure

the act of leaving or departing
Gehen nWeggehen nAbreise f
  • His going was unexpected and sudden.Sein Weggehen war unerwartet und plötzlich.

Adjective

1.

current

UK
currently happening or existing
UK
  • The going rate for babysitting is $15 an hour.Der derzeitige Stundensatz fürs Babysitten beträgt 15 Dollar.
2.

viable

likely to continue or succeed
  • The project is still a going concern.Das Projekt ist noch bestehend.
3.

commerce

available for use or purchase
  • The best seats are still going.Die besten Plätze sind noch verfügbar.
